[Add] AlibabacloudMse20190531 6.13.0
[CocoaPods.git] / Specs / 6 / 4 / 1 / ZXToolbox / 2.1.5 / ZXToolbox.podspec.json
blob2e68b852e95c5cb4c83ef6bb10f93ba0290507c0
2   "name": "ZXToolbox",
3   "version": "2.1.5",
4   "summary": "Development kit for iOS",
5   "description": "Development kit for iOS.",
6   "homepage": "https://github.com/xinyzhao/ZXToolbox",
7   "license": {
8     "type": "MIT",
9     "file": "LICENSE"
10   },
11   "authors": {
12     "xinyzhao": "xinyzhao@qq.com"
13   },
14   "platforms": {
15     "ios": "7.0"
16   },
17   "source": {
18     "git": "https://github.com/xinyzhao/ZXToolbox.git",
19     "tag": "2.1.5"
20   },
21   "requires_arc": true,
22   "frameworks": [
23     "Foundation",
24     "UIKit"
25   ],
26   "source_files": "ZXToolbox/ZXToolbox.h",
27   "public_header_files": "ZXToolbox/ZXToolbox.h",
28   "subspecs": [
29     {
30       "name": "Base64Encoding",
31       "source_files": "ZXToolbox/Foundation/Base64Encoding/*.{h,m}",
32       "public_header_files": "ZXToolbox/Foundation/Base64Encoding/*.h"
33     },
34     {
35       "name": "JSONObject",
36       "source_files": "ZXToolbox/Foundation/JSONObject/*.{h,m}",
37       "public_header_files": "ZXToolbox/Foundation/JSONObject/*.h"
38     },
39     {
40       "name": "NSArray+ZXToolbox",
41       "source_files": "ZXToolbox/Foundation/NSArray+ZXToolbox/*.{h,m}",
42       "public_header_files": "ZXToolbox/Foundation/NSArray+ZXToolbox/*.h"
43     },
44     {
45       "name": "NSDate+ZXToolbox",
46       "source_files": "ZXToolbox/Foundation/NSDate+ZXToolbox/*.{h,m}",
47       "public_header_files": "ZXToolbox/Foundation/NSDate+ZXToolbox/*.h"
48     },
49     {
50       "name": "NSFileManager+ZXToolbox",
51       "source_files": "ZXToolbox/Foundation/NSFileManager+ZXToolbox/*.{h,m}",
52       "public_header_files": "ZXToolbox/Foundation/NSFileManager+ZXToolbox/*.h"
53     },
54     {
55       "name": "NSNumberFormatter+ZXToolbox",
56       "source_files": "ZXToolbox/Foundation/NSNumberFormatter+ZXToolbox/*.{h,m}",
57       "public_header_files": "ZXToolbox/Foundation/NSNumberFormatter+ZXToolbox/*.h"
58     },
59     {
60       "name": "NSObject+ZXToolbox",
61       "source_files": "ZXToolbox/Foundation/NSObject+ZXToolbox/*.{h,m}",
62       "public_header_files": "ZXToolbox/Foundation/NSObject+ZXToolbox/*.h"
63     },
64     {
65       "name": "NSString+NumberValue",
66       "source_files": "ZXToolbox/Foundation/NSString+NumberValue/*.{h,m}",
67       "public_header_files": "ZXToolbox/Foundation/NSString+NumberValue/*.h"
68     },
69     {
70       "name": "NSString+Pinyin",
71       "source_files": "ZXToolbox/Foundation/NSString+Pinyin/*.{h,m}",
72       "public_header_files": "ZXToolbox/Foundation/NSString+Pinyin/*.h"
73     },
74     {
75       "name": "NSString+Unicode",
76       "dependencies": {
77         "ZXToolbox/NSObject+ZXToolbox": [
79         ]
80       },
81       "source_files": "ZXToolbox/Foundation/NSString+Unicode/*.{h,m}",
82       "public_header_files": "ZXToolbox/Foundation/NSString+Unicode/*.h"
83     },
84     {
85       "name": "NSString+URLEncoding",
86       "source_files": "ZXToolbox/Foundation/NSString+URLEncoding/*.{h,m}",
87       "public_header_files": "ZXToolbox/Foundation/NSString+URLEncoding/*.h"
88     },
89     {
90       "name": "UIApplication+ZXToolbox",
91       "source_files": "ZXToolbox/UIKit/UIApplication+ZXToolbox/*.{h,m}",
92       "public_header_files": "ZXToolbox/UIKit/UIApplication+ZXToolbox/*.h"
93     },
94     {
95       "name": "UIApplicationIdleTimer",
96       "source_files": "ZXToolbox/UIKit/UIApplicationIdleTimer/*.{h,m}",
97       "public_header_files": "ZXToolbox/UIKit/UIApplicationIdleTimer/*.h"
98     },
99     {
100       "name": "UIButton+ZXToolbox",
101       "source_files": "ZXToolbox/UIKit/UIButton+ZXToolbox/*.{h,m}",
102       "public_header_files": "ZXToolbox/UIKit/UIButton+ZXToolbox/*.h"
103     },
104     {
105       "name": "UIColor+ZXToolbox",
106       "source_files": "ZXToolbox/UIKit/UIColor+ZXToolbox/*.{h,m}",
107       "public_header_files": "ZXToolbox/UIKit/UIColor+ZXToolbox/*.h"
108     },
109     {
110       "name": "UIControl+ZXToolbox",
111       "source_files": "ZXToolbox/UIKit/UIControl+ZXToolbox/*.{h,m}",
112       "public_header_files": "ZXToolbox/UIKit/UIControl+ZXToolbox/*.h"
113     },
114     {
115       "name": "UIImage+ZXToolbox",
116       "source_files": "ZXToolbox/UIKit/UIImage+ZXToolbox/*.{h,m}",
117       "public_header_files": "ZXToolbox/UIKit/UIImage+ZXToolbox/*.h",
118       "frameworks": [
119         "CoreGraphics",
120         "ImageIO"
121       ]
122     },
123     {
124       "name": "UINetworkActivityIndicator",
125       "source_files": "ZXToolbox/UIKit/UINetworkActivityIndicator/*.{h,m}",
126       "public_header_files": "ZXToolbox/UIKit/UINetworkActivityIndicator/*.h"
127     },
128     {
129       "name": "UIScreen+ZXToolbox",
130       "source_files": "ZXToolbox/UIKit/UIScreen+ZXToolbox/*.{h,m}",
131       "public_header_files": "ZXToolbox/UIKit/UIScreen+ZXToolbox/*.h"
132     },
133     {
134       "name": "UIScrollView+ZXToolbox",
135       "source_files": "ZXToolbox/UIKit/UIScrollView+ZXToolbox/*.{h,m}",
136       "public_header_files": "ZXToolbox/UIKit/UIScrollView+ZXToolbox/*.h"
137     },
138     {
139       "name": "UITableViewCell+Separator",
140       "source_files": "ZXToolbox/UIKit/UITableViewCell+Separator/*.{h,m}",
141       "public_header_files": "ZXToolbox/UIKit/UITableViewCell+Separator/*.h"
142     },
143     {
144       "name": "UITextField+ZXToolbox",
145       "dependencies": {
146         "ZXToolbox/NSObject+ZXToolbox": [
148         ]
149       },
150       "source_files": "ZXToolbox/UIKit/UITextField+ZXToolbox/*.{h,m}",
151       "public_header_files": "ZXToolbox/UIKit/UITextField+ZXToolbox/*.h"
152     },
153     {
154       "name": "UIView+ZXToolbox",
155       "dependencies": {
156         "ZXToolbox/NSObject+ZXToolbox": [
158         ]
159       },
160       "source_files": "ZXToolbox/UIKit/UIView+ZXToolbox/*.{h,m}",
161       "public_header_files": "ZXToolbox/UIKit/UIView+ZXToolbox/*.h"
162     },
163     {
164       "name": "UIViewController+ZXToolbox",
165       "source_files": "ZXToolbox/UIKit/UIViewController+ZXToolbox/*.{h,m}",
166       "public_header_files": "ZXToolbox/UIKit/UIViewController+ZXToolbox/*.h"
167     },
168     {
169       "name": "ZXAlertView",
170       "source_files": "ZXToolbox/ZXKit/ZXAlertView/*.{h,m}",
171       "public_header_files": "ZXToolbox/ZXKit/ZXAlertView/*.h"
172     },
173     {
174       "name": "ZXAudioDevice",
175       "source_files": "ZXToolbox/ZXKit/ZXAudioDevice/*.{h,m}",
176       "public_header_files": "ZXToolbox/ZXKit/ZXAudioDevice/*.h",
177       "frameworks": "AVFoundation"
178     },
179     {
180       "name": "ZXAuthorizationHelper",
181       "source_files": "ZXToolbox/ZXKit/ZXAuthorizationHelper/*.{h,m}",
182       "public_header_files": "ZXToolbox/ZXKit/ZXAuthorizationHelper/*.h",
183       "frameworks": [
184         "AddressBook",
185         "AssetsLibrary",
186         "AVFoundation",
187         "CoreLocation"
188       ],
189       "weak_frameworks": [
190         "Contacts",
191         "CoreTelephony",
192         "Photos"
193       ]
194     },
195     {
196       "name": "ZXBadgeLabel",
197       "source_files": "ZXToolbox/ZXKit/ZXBadgeLabel/*.{h,m}",
198       "public_header_files": "ZXToolbox/ZXKit/ZXBadgeLabel/*.h"
199     },
200     {
201       "name": "ZXBrightnessView",
202       "dependencies": {
203         "ZXToolbox/UIColor+ZXToolbox": [
205         ]
206       },
207       "source_files": "ZXToolbox/ZXKit/ZXBrightnessView/*.{h,m}",
208       "public_header_files": "ZXToolbox/ZXKit/ZXBrightnessView/*.h",
209       "resources": "ZXToolbox/ZXKit/ZXBrightnessView/ZXBrightnessView.bundle"
210     },
211     {
212       "name": "ZXCircularProgressView",
213       "source_files": "ZXToolbox/ZXKit/ZXCircularProgressView/*.{h,m}",
214       "public_header_files": "ZXToolbox/ZXKit/ZXCircularProgressView/*.h"
215     },
216     {
217       "name": "ZXCommonCrypto",
218       "source_files": "ZXToolbox/ZXKit/ZXCommonCrypto/*.{h,m}",
219       "public_header_files": "ZXToolbox/ZXKit/ZXCommonCrypto/*.h"
220     },
221     {
222       "name": "ZXDownloadManager",
223       "dependencies": {
224         "ZXToolbox/ZXCommonCrypto": [
226         ]
227       },
228       "source_files": "ZXToolbox/ZXKit/ZXDownloadManager/*.{h,m}",
229       "public_header_files": "ZXToolbox/ZXKit/ZXDownloadManager/*.h"
230     },
231     {
232       "name": "ZXDrawingView",
233       "source_files": "ZXToolbox/ZXKit/ZXDrawingView/*.{h,m}",
234       "public_header_files": "ZXToolbox/ZXKit/ZXDrawingView/*.h"
235     },
236     {
237       "name": "ZXHaloLabel",
238       "source_files": "ZXToolbox/ZXKit/ZXHaloLabel/*.{h,m}",
239       "public_header_files": "ZXToolbox/ZXKit/ZXHaloLabel/*.h"
240     },
241     {
242       "name": "ZXHTTPClient",
243       "source_files": "ZXToolbox/ZXKit/ZXHTTPClient/*.{h,m}",
244       "public_header_files": "ZXToolbox/ZXKit/ZXHTTPClient/*.h",
245       "frameworks": "Security"
246     },
247     {
248       "name": "ZXLineChartView",
249       "source_files": "ZXToolbox/ZXKit/ZXLineChartView/*.{h,m}",
250       "public_header_files": "ZXToolbox/ZXKit/ZXLineChartView/*.h"
251     },
252     {
253       "name": "ZXLocalAuthentication",
254       "source_files": "ZXToolbox/ZXKit/ZXLocalAuthentication/*.{h,m}",
255       "public_header_files": "ZXToolbox/ZXKit/ZXLocalAuthentication/*.h",
256       "weak_frameworks": "LocalAuthentication"
257     },
258     {
259       "name": "ZXLocationManager",
260       "source_files": "ZXToolbox/ZXKit/ZXLocationManager/*.{h,m}",
261       "public_header_files": "ZXToolbox/ZXKit/ZXLocationManager/*.h",
262       "frameworks": "CoreLocation"
263     },
264     {
265       "name": "ZXNavigationController",
266       "source_files": "ZXToolbox/ZXKit/ZXNavigationController/*.{h,m}",
267       "public_header_files": "ZXToolbox/ZXKit/ZXNavigationController/*.h"
268     },
269     {
270       "name": "ZXNetworkTrafficMonitor",
271       "source_files": "ZXToolbox/ZXKit/ZXNetworkTrafficMonitor/*.{h,m}",
272       "public_header_files": "ZXToolbox/ZXKit/ZXNetworkTrafficMonitor/*.h"
273     },
274     {
275       "name": "ZXPageIndicatorView",
276       "source_files": "ZXToolbox/ZXKit/ZXPageIndicatorView/*.{h,m}",
277       "public_header_files": "ZXToolbox/ZXKit/ZXPageIndicatorView/*.h"
278     },
279     {
280       "name": "ZXPageView",
281       "dependencies": {
282         "ZXToolbox/ZXTimer": [
284         ]
285       },
286       "source_files": "ZXToolbox/ZXKit/ZXPageView/*.{h,m}",
287       "public_header_files": "ZXToolbox/ZXKit/ZXPageView/*.h"
288     },
289     {
290       "name": "ZXPhotoLibrary",
291       "source_files": "ZXToolbox/ZXKit/ZXPhotoLibrary/*.{h,m}",
292       "public_header_files": "ZXToolbox/ZXKit/ZXPhotoLibrary/*.h",
293       "frameworks": [
294         "AssetsLibrary",
295         "CoreGraphics",
296         "ImageIO"
297       ],
298       "weak_frameworks": "Photos"
299     },
300     {
301       "name": "ZXPlayerViewController",
302       "dependencies": {
303         "ZXToolbox/NSObject+ZXToolbox": [
305         ],
306         "ZXToolbox/UIViewController+ZXToolbox": [
308         ],
309         "ZXToolbox/ZXBrightnessView": [
311         ]
312       },
313       "source_files": "ZXToolbox/ZXKit/ZXPlayerViewController/*.{h,m}",
314       "public_header_files": "ZXToolbox/ZXKit/ZXPlayerViewController/*.h",
315       "frameworks": [
316         "AVFoundation",
317         "MediaPlayer"
318       ]
319     },
320     {
321       "name": "ZXPopoverView",
322       "source_files": "ZXToolbox/ZXKit/ZXPopoverView/*.{h,m}",
323       "public_header_files": "ZXToolbox/ZXKit/ZXPopoverView/*.h"
324     },
325     {
326       "name": "ZXPopoverWindow",
327       "source_files": "ZXToolbox/ZXKit/ZXPopoverWindow/*.{h,m}",
328       "public_header_files": "ZXToolbox/ZXKit/ZXPopoverWindow/*.h"
329     },
330     {
331       "name": "ZXQRCodeGenerator",
332       "source_files": "ZXToolbox/ZXKit/ZXQRCodeGenerator/*.{h,m}",
333       "public_header_files": "ZXToolbox/ZXKit/ZXQRCodeGenerator/*.h"
334     },
335     {
336       "name": "ZXQRCodeReader",
337       "source_files": "ZXToolbox/ZXKit/ZXQRCodeReader/*.{h,m}",
338       "public_header_files": "ZXToolbox/ZXKit/ZXQRCodeReader/*.h"
339     },
340     {
341       "name": "ZXQRCodeScanner",
342       "source_files": "ZXToolbox/ZXKit/ZXQRCodeScanner/*.{h,m}",
343       "public_header_files": "ZXToolbox/ZXKit/ZXQRCodeScanner/*.h",
344       "frameworks": [
345         "AVFoundation",
346         "ImageIO"
347       ]
348     },
349     {
350       "name": "ZXScriptMessageHandler",
351       "platforms": {
352         "ios": "8.0"
353       },
354       "source_files": "ZXToolbox/ZXKit/ZXScriptMessageHandler/*.{h,m}",
355       "public_header_files": "ZXToolbox/ZXKit/ZXScriptMessageHandler/*.h",
356       "frameworks": "WebKit"
357     },
358     {
359       "name": "ZXScrollLabel",
360       "source_files": "ZXToolbox/ZXKit/ZXScrollLabel/*.{h,m}",
361       "public_header_files": "ZXToolbox/ZXKit/ZXScrollLabel/*.h"
362     },
363     {
364       "name": "ZXStackView",
365       "source_files": "ZXToolbox/ZXKit/ZXStackView/*.{h,m}",
366       "public_header_files": "ZXToolbox/ZXKit/ZXStackView/*.h"
367     },
368     {
369       "name": "ZXTabBar",
370       "source_files": "ZXToolbox/ZXKit/ZXTabBar/*.{h,m}",
371       "public_header_files": "ZXToolbox/ZXKit/ZXTabBar/*.h"
372     },
373     {
374       "name": "ZXTabBarController",
375       "source_files": "ZXToolbox/ZXKit/ZXTabBarController/*.{h,m}",
376       "public_header_files": "ZXToolbox/ZXKit/ZXTabBarController/*.h"
377     },
378     {
379       "name": "ZXTagView",
380       "source_files": "ZXToolbox/ZXKit/ZXTagView/*.{h,m}",
381       "public_header_files": "ZXToolbox/ZXKit/ZXTagView/*.h"
382     },
383     {
384       "name": "ZXTimer",
385       "source_files": "ZXToolbox/ZXKit/ZXTimer/*.{h,m}",
386       "public_header_files": "ZXToolbox/ZXKit/ZXTimer/*.h"
387     },
388     {
389       "name": "ZXToastView",
390       "source_files": "ZXToolbox/ZXKit/ZXToastView/*.{h,m}",
391       "public_header_files": "ZXToolbox/ZXKit/ZXToastView/*.h"
392     },
393     {
394       "name": "ZXToolbox+Macros",
395       "dependencies": {
396         "ZXToolbox/NSDate+ZXToolbox": [
398         ]
399       },
400       "source_files": "ZXToolbox/ZXKit/ZXToolbox+Macros/*.{h,m}",
401       "public_header_files": "ZXToolbox/ZXKit/ZXToolbox+Macros/*.h"
402     },
403     {
404       "name": "ZXURLProtocol",
405       "source_files": "ZXToolbox/ZXKit/ZXURLProtocol/*.{h,m}",
406       "public_header_files": "ZXToolbox/ZXKit/ZXURLProtocol/*.h",
407       "frameworks": [
408         "CoreFoundation",
409         "MobileCoreServices"
410       ]
411     },
412     {
413       "name": "ZXURLSession",
414       "source_files": "ZXToolbox/ZXKit/ZXURLSession/*.{h,m}",
415       "public_header_files": "ZXToolbox/ZXKit/ZXURLSession/*.h"
416     }
417   ]